Rated 1 out of 5 stars

Untrustworthy insurance company

Health insurance:

16 months into the insurance, I got an extremely painful sinusitis, which needed surgery. Instead of approving it, they falsely claimed it was a pre-existing condition with no justification whatsoever and no information about how to complain.

Luckily, I found a scan report from 1997 that contradicted AdvanceCare's baseless claim that this was a pre-existing condition. Also, Portuguese insurance law only allows exclusions of pre-existing conditions for 12 months.

The discussion with them prolonged the strong pain with two weeks, during which I had to eat loads of strong painkillers to be able to function. This is institutionalised torture and a breach of contract.

They finally approved it, but not without refusing cover for one of the necessary acts. Thankfully, Trofa Saúde accepted to do it anyway.

Twice, I had to discuss with them to get cover for vitamin blood tests, which are included. The same happened with ENT consultations. Months of discussion each time, but they finally paid. Of course they hope most people give up.

When I wanted to give notice to switch to another insurer 3 months before the expiry, they refused to accept the notice until 30 days before expiry. This is in violation of Portuguese insurance law.

Generali Tranquilidade happily break the law when it suits them. It seems to be a part of their business model, which includes exhausting the insured with endless discussion.

Car insurance:

When a careless driver reversed into my car, it was very difficult to follow the status of the claims handling. I tried to call them, but as I don't speak Portuguese yet, they said an English speaker would call back. They never did. I had to call my insurance agent. It was the other driver's insurance that had to cover the cost, and the repair was finally done correctly. At least I got the included replacement car.

I am going to get rid of the rest of my Generali Tranquilidade insurances. I don't trust them any more.
